The Story So Far announce ‘I Want to Disappear’ tour
Bay Area rockers The Story So Far have announced they’ll be touring extensively across America later in 2024 behind their newest album ‘I Want to Disappear’. The 16-date tour kicks off November 21st in Nashville and continues into December making notable stops in Chicago, Brooklyn, Philadelphia, Atlanta, Orlando, Houston, Los Angeles and their hometown of San Francisco. Joining the tour in support will be special guests Superheaven and Koyo.
The Story So Far released their fifth studio album ‘I Want to Disappear’ on June 21st, 2024 via Pure Noise Records. The new album follows up 2018’s ‘Proper Dose’ which reached a career-best #19 on the Billboard 200. Back in 2022, the band launched a massive U.S. tour which was joined by Joyce Manor, Mom Jeans and Microwave. The prior year, they hit the road with support from Movements. The group formed in 2007 and currently consists of members Parker Cannon, Kevin Geyer, Will Levy and Ryan Torf.
